Hi again.

RAC man been out to fix car.

5 fuses had blown. 4 got replaced, but i need to go and get a 120 amp alternator fuse tomorrow.

Said i blew them by putting jump leads on wrong way round! am convinced i didnt. anyhow, tried to get the 120 amp fuse out and having great difficulty.

2 screws are keeping it in and the fuse compartment just wont come out?? not sure if wires have no give in them or the 4 clips, locks ( not sure of name ) wont release. tried unscrewing the outer housing but not much movement in that either.

is there an easy way to do this, and am i missng something obvious. RAC man couldnt do it iether and gave up after 20 mins.
